What Is The Relationship Between Liquid Pressure And Depth?

What Is The Relationship Between Liquid Pressure And Depth? Pressure and depth have a directly proportional relationship. This is due to the greater column of water that pushes down on an object submersed. Conversely, as objects are lifted, and the depth decreases, pressure is reduced. What Is The Definition Of Upthrust In Physics?

What Is The Definition Of Upthrust In Physics? An object that is partly, or completely, submerged experiences a greater pressure on its bottom surface than on its top surface. This causes a resultant force upwards. This force is called upthrust . The upthrust force is equal in size to the weight of the fluid displaced
